Gospel Library 5.0 for Android has been released on the Google Play Store and will be available soon on the Amazon Appstore (for Kindle Fire devices). Gospel Library 5.0 for Android supports Android 4.4 and later. Here are the release notes:

In Gospel Library 5, we provide quick and easy access to gospel materials. We have made several changes to reduce the size and frequency of content updates. We are also introducing better navigation throughout the app.

NEW:
• Added background content updating to minimize updates while using the app.
• Reduced the size of the app by downloading and storing content more efficiently.
• Added chapter grid for quicker navigation in the scriptures.
• Added Speakers and Topics tabs in the General Conference section.
• Added speaker names to subtitles for general conference talks in search and notes.
• Search shows all results in a single list.
• Added a menu option for printing content.
• Picture-in-picture support for videos (Android 8+).
• Simplified verse call-out style when following links.
• Audio player shows a message when it automatically switches to text-to-speech.
• Added Audio and Screen settings to the Settings section of the app.
• Added 3x option to the audio playback speed.
• Added ability to re-enter your LDS Account password without signing out.
• Added ability to remove downloaded languages from the Languages menu.
• Added App Details section in Settings for better troubleshooting.
• Added support for app links using Gospel Library Online URLs.
• Updated sharing to use Gospel Library Online URLs.

FIXED:
• Bug where Define button didn't work on some devices.
• Bug where footnote links to content outside of Gospel Library failed to load.
• Bug where changes to a note weren't always reflected after saving.
• Bug where Limit Mobile Network Use didn't prevent video streaming.
• Bug where audio stopped playing while navigating the app.
• Bug where audio player stopped working after pausing and switching apps.
• Bug where continuous play didn't work while casting audio.
• Bug where audio stopped playing when the next chapter didn't have audio.
• Bug where male and female audio recordings weren't separated in Downloaded Media.
• Bug where screens disappeared when toggling "Show Screens as Separate Windows" on or off.

I have had to download most content again. This is important to note, so that you will be able to get the things you need downloaded at home or elsewhere before you head to Church on Sunday, or else you are in for a big surprise.

I discovered it with the first bookmark I clicked on as I was preparing to teach Sunday.

Yes, the new content format requires books to be downloaded again – thanks for pointing that out. Books are smaller, so they will download faster than before. Hopefully releasing on Wednesday will help some (giving people time to update before Sunday).
